Firstly, and arguably most critically, logging in allows you to fortify your network's security. When you first get your Airtel WiFi router, it usually comes with a default Wi-Fi name (SSID) and a pre-set password. These are often generic and, frankly, not very secure. With admin access, you can easily change your Wi-Fi password to a strong, unique one, ideally using WPA2 or even WPA3 encryption if your router supports it. This is paramount to preventing unauthorized access to your network, protecting your personal data, and keeping those freeloading neighbors from siphoning off your bandwidth. Seriously, don't underestimate the power of a strong password! Beyond basic security, you gain unparalleled network control. Ever wondered who's connected to your Wi-Fi? The admin panel shows you a list of all connected devices. This is super handy for spotting unknown devices or even booting off devices you no longer want connected. You can also implement Quality of Service (QoS) settings to prioritize bandwidth for important activities, like online gaming or video conferencing, ensuring a smooth experience even when multiple devices are in use. This level of granular control is something you just can't get without logging in. Furthermore, Airtel router login lets you customize your network to your heart's content. Tired of that generic Wi-Fi name? Change it! Want to separate your smart home devices from your main network for added security? Set up a guest network! You can also adjust Wi-Fi channels to avoid interference from neighboring networks, which can significantly boost your signal strength and speed. These customizations make your network truly yours. Troubleshooting becomes a breeze too. If you're experiencing slow speeds or connectivity issues, the router's diagnostics tools, accessible via the admin panel, can help you identify the root cause. You can check connection logs, signal strength, and even perform speed tests directly from the router interface. This saves you a lot of time and frustration, often allowing you to fix issues without calling customer support. Lastly, but certainly not least, logging in gives you access to advanced features like parental controls, port forwarding, and firmware updates. Parental controls are a lifesaver for families, allowing you to block inappropriate websites or set time limits for internet access for specific devices. Port forwarding is essential for gamers or anyone running a server, enabling specific applications to communicate directly with the internet. And firmware updates? These are crucial for patching security vulnerabilities, improving performance, and adding new features to your Airtel WiFi router. The prep work might seem minor, but trust me, it’ll save you a ton of headaches down the line. First things first, you need to identify your router model. While the login process is generally similar across most Airtel WiFi router models, specific IP addresses or default credentials can sometimes vary slightly. Knowing your model (e.g., Huawei, D-Link, ZTE, Nokia) can be helpful if you need to look up very specific defaults. You’ll usually find this information on a sticker on the bottom or back of the router itself. Speaking of stickers, this leads us to the absolute most critical piece of information: your Airtel router IP address, username, and password.
